Plugin authors,

Next Tuesday we run a disaster-recovery drill on BloomGate, the bloom filter sitting in front of the Kestrel key-value store. The filter's bit array will be rebuilt from a snapshot, so plugins may briefly see elevated false-positive rates; please confirm your retry logic tolerates this. If your plugin maintains its own filter shard, you'll need to unlock the shard archive to participate in the rebuild. The archive prompt asks for the recovery passphrase, provided immediately below.

strongbox words: norwyn-wenael-aldvan-aldiel-wendor-holael

## Runbook: Quillkit version bumps

Quick refresher for the eng sync crowd: the Quillkit component library uses strict semver, and the release bot blocks any merge that changes a public prop without a major bump. If a downstream app breaks after a minor release, someone probably snuck in a breaking change — check the changelog diff first, then pin the previous version while we sort it out. Don't hand-edit lockfiles in prod branches. The full versioning policy, including the deprecation timeline, lives on the internal page below.

wiki page, bagaf-fawip: https://harbor.tolvaqsys.local/pages/repo/pages/secrets/eac969ffc71f356b

Handing off the Quillgate DNS flakiness to Priya. Resolution fails intermittently on the batch nodes only, roughly 1 in 40 lookups, always against the internal zone. Caching daemon restart clears it for a few hours. Suspect the stale forwarder entry from the Harlow datacenter move. No code change needed for the release; mitigation is config-only. Current resolver settings on the affected nodes are as follows.

settings of yahag-yafog:
[pramir]
host = pramir.qirvancorp.internal
user = pramir_svc
database = pramir_prod

## Step 4: Swap the autocomplete widget

Replace the legacy Addrly widget with PinpointBox v3. Suggestions now debounce at 250 ms and return structured locality fields; free-text fallback is gone. Support should expect tickets about missing rural matches — point users to manual entry. Before shipping, set the widget options exactly as shown below.

config for bagep-bajog:
[praax]
port = 4000
region = north-4
host = praax.norvagrid.local
team = juldor
timeout_ms = 2000
retries = 5